[Detailed description of the invention] [Industrial application field] This invention is designed to inhale, load, and transport and treat solids and sludge that have settled at the bottom of sewage, such as sewers, manholes, and gas station car wash ditches. It concerns sludge trucks.

Usually, the sludge truck is a car 1 as shown in Figure 5.
A cylindrical sludge tank 2 and a vacuum generator, for example, a vacuum pump unit 3 are mounted on the top, and the inside of the sludge tank 2 is evacuated and depressurized by the vacuum pump unit 3, and a suction hose is led out from the top of the sludge tank 2. Sludge water from sewerage, etc. is sucked into the sludge tank 2 through the sludge tank 2 (not shown).

By the way, in this type of sludge truck, when sucking and loading sludge water into the sludge tank 2, the sludge water that has entered the sludge tank 2 is discharged and only a large amount of sludge is loaded, and this is specified. If the sludge is transported and discharged to a location, sludge treatment work can be carried out efficiently and economically.

Therefore, in the conventional sludge truck, drainage pots are installed in stages on the side wall of the sludge tank 2 at appropriate intervals in the vertical direction, and sludge water is continuously sucked into the sludge tank 2.
The drainage pots are opened and closed in sequence starting from the bottom one. That is, when the sewage level in the sludge tank 2 rises to the level of the lower drain tank, it is opened and the sewage is discharged. When the upper surface of the sludge deposited on the bottom of the sludge tank 2 rises to near the level of the lower drainage tank, this drainage tank is closed and the next upper drainage tank is opened.

However, if the drainage pots are installed in stages on the side wall of the sludge tank 2 at appropriate intervals in the vertical direction as described above, and the drain pots are opened and closed sequentially starting from the bottom one, it becomes difficult for the operator to switch each drainage pot and to It takes time to connect and replace the drain hose. Furthermore, it is not easy to manufacture the sludge tank 2 because it is necessary to provide drainage pots in stages at appropriate intervals in the vertical direction on the side wall of the sludge tank 2.

This idea was made in view of the above problems, and the sludge collection and treatment work can be carried out efficiently and economically.
The object is to provide a sludge truck that is easy to manufacture and install.

By the above means, the sludge in the sludge water sucked into the sludge tank settles and accumulates inside the tank body which is stopped by the chain screen, and the sewage passes through the chain screen and overflows from the weir plate on the rear side. Furthermore, the water passes through the pores in the punch plate on the rear surface and is drained from the drainage pot provided in the hatch.

FIG. 1 is a longitudinal section of the rear part of the sludge truck according to this invention, and 11 is a sludge tank mounted on the vehicle.
A cylindrical tank body 12;
hinge 13 of suitable means in place on the rear opening surface of the
It consists of a hatch 14 which is suspended in the closed position so that it can be reversed and opened via the hatch 14. A flange 15 is integrally formed on the peripheral edge of the rear opening surface of the tank body 12 so as to protrude outward. Further, a flange 16 is integrally formed on the periphery of the opening of the hatch 14 to fit with the flange 15, and a seal 18 is attached to an annular groove 17 formed in the flange 16, so that the hatch 14 can be closed to the tank body 12 in a watertight manner. I have to. 1
9 is a chain screen installed on the rear opening surface of the tank body 12 of the sludge tank 11, and as shown in FIG. 2, a large number of chains 19a, 19a...
... are arranged in parallel in contact with each other over the entire widthwise length of the tank body 12, and each chain 19
a, 19a... are inserted into the tank body 12 from the upper end of the inner surface 14' of the hatch 14 and suspended by fixing their upper ends to the tips of a large number of protruding support rods 20, 20..., respectively. At the same time, the lower ends are respectively brought into contact with the inner circumferential surface of the tank body 12.
